The opportunity EY Tax is a market leader, renowned for delivering sustainable growth and empowering our people to shape their own careers. Our diverse, collaborative team advises on high-profile transactions, combining technical expertise, innovation and a genuine focus on continuous development. Join us to work on challenging, multi-country projects in a supportive, dynamic environment where your impact truly matters. We help clients assess their international tax strategies and exposure and address a range of international tax issues. This may include planning expansion into new strategic or regional markets while working with colleagues to achieve accurate reporting in existing locations and to manage productive relationships with the tax authorities.

How to prepare for a job interview at EY
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your transfer pricing knowledge and the latest tax regulations. Familiarise yourself with EY's approach to international tax strategies, as well as any recent high-profile cases they've handled. This will show that you're not just interested in the role but also invested in the company's work.
✨Showcase Your Experience
Prepare specific examples from your past roles where you've successfully managed complex tax issues or built strong client relationships.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, making it easy for the interviewers to see your impact.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Come prepared with th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, ongoing projects, or EY's future direction in transfer pricing. This demonstrates your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if the company culture aligns with your values.
